Chateau Cheval Blanc, Saint-Emilion Grand Cru, France 2018 La Cigarrera near Austria’s Hungarian borderLove the floral character to the aromas of dark fruit, such as blueberries and black cherries. Red and black licorice, too. The full bodied palate starts slowly and then expands with super polished, searing tannins that lead you up the palate into a place of grandeur. Lightly chewy at the end. Such great purity and presence here. 6% cabernet sauvignon in the blend with franc and merlot. 99 Pts James Suckling
